About Sexual Abuse Law in Cayman Islands:

Sexual abuse is a serious crime in the Cayman Islands that can have long-lasting consequences for the victim. Whether the abuse occurred recently or in the past, it is important to seek legal advice to understand your rights and options for seeking justice.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

If you have been a victim of sexual abuse, you may need a lawyer to help you navigate the legal system and seek compensation for any damages you have suffered. A lawyer can also help you understand your rights, gather evidence, and represent you in court.

Local Laws Overview:

In the Cayman Islands, sexual abuse is prohibited under the Criminal Code. This includes offenses such as rape, sexual assault, and indecent assault. The penalties for these crimes can be severe, including imprisonment and fines. It is important to report any instances of sexual abuse to the police as soon as possible to ensure that the perpetrator is held accountable.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q: What should I do if I have been sexually abused?

A: If you have been sexually abused, it is important to seek medical attention and report the abuse to the police as soon as possible. You may also consider seeking legal advice to understand your options for seeking justice.

Q: Can I sue my abuser for damages?

A: Yes, you may be able to sue your abuser for damages, including compensation for any physical or emotional injuries you have suffered as a result of the abuse. A lawyer can help you understand the process and represent you in court.

Q: Is there a time limit for filing a claim for sexual abuse?

A: In the Cayman Islands, there is a limitation period for filing claims for sexual abuse. It is important to seek legal advice as soon as possible to ensure that your claim is filed within the required time frame.

Additional Resources:

If you need legal advice or support related to sexual abuse, you can contact the Family Resource Centre, the Department of Children and Family Services, or the Royal Cayman Islands Police Service for assistance. These organizations can provide you with information, support, and resources to help you seek justice.
